Case Summary: MA 1701/2026 On 27-05-2026, the Supreme Court heard a Miscellaneous Application arising from an earlier judgment in SMW(Crl) No. 1/2025. The court granted a four-week extension requested by Justice Aniruddha Bose (Director, National Judicial Academy, Bhopal) to constitute a Committee of Experts as per the court's 10-02-2026 order. The Miscellaneous Application was disposed of accordingly. This case analysis is maintained by casestatus.in based on publicly available court records.
